Engine & Transmission

The Abarth 595 is a compact hatchback with a 1.4L turbocharged inline-4 engine producing 145 horsepower and 206 Nm of torque. It features a front-wheel drive layout, 5-speed automatic transmission, and a McPherson strut suspension at the front and a semi-independent coil spring suspension at the rear.

Brakes

The car in question is a 595 model with ventilated disc brakes in the front (284 mm) and disc brakes in the rear (240 mm). It is equipped with electric power steering and has a tire size of 194/45 R16. The steering type is rack and pinion and the wheel rims size is 16. The car also has an Anti-lock braking system (ABS) as an assisting system.
